UMass Amherst Brings MassImpact Day to Springfield

The Henry M. Thomas III Center at Springfield is excited to play a part in this year's MassImpact Day of Service on Saturday, September 19, 2026. As part of this annual day of service, we anticipate welcoming approximately 30-40 UMass student volunteers to Springfield to work alongside local nonprofit organizations and support their missions.

Students will provide hands-on assistance in areas such as identifying prospective donors using UMass public databases, creating flyers and marketing materials, providing feedback on websites and social media, and supporting "friendraising" efforts that help nonprofits build stronger relationships within the community.

Hosting MassImpact Day at the Henry M. Thomas III Center will give students an opportunity to experience the Center and engage directly with the Greater Springfield community. It will also create a welcoming opportunity for nonprofits of all types and sizes including organizations beyond Amherst to participate and benefit from the skills and talents of UMass volunteers.

We are proud to help bring more of UMass to the community and more of the community to UMass through a day focused on service, collaboration, and building stronger connections across the region.
